The launch of OnePlus 11 has been the subject of official teases. The company took to Weibo to reveal the design trailer for the upcoming flagship smartphone. The OnePlus 11 5G is expected to launch early next year. The company’s teaser video shows off the redesigned camera module of the OnePlus 11 5G. The teaser confirms that the render of the leaked design was actually legit.
We can see the circular camera module with the Hasselblad brand in the center. The device is also confirmed to feature a triple camera setup at the back with an LED flash module. One of the colors of the next OnePlus flagship is also confirmed. Let’s take a look at the OnePlus 11 5G launch details, specs, and everything else known so far.
OnePlus 11 5G launch is imminent
The OnePlus 11 5G could debut early next year in China. The company is expected to announce the official launch date very soon. The phone is also expected to arrive in India in the first quarter of 2023.
The trailer does not confirm the release date, but it does confirm that the new flagship Android smartphone will feature an alert slider. The circular camera module will house a triple camera setup and an LED flash. From the looks of it, the phone is likely to get a glossy black paint job on the rear as well. It will also likely have a glass back and a metal frame.
While OnePlus didn’t reveal any details, the rumor mill has covered our interests. The phone is likely to launch in a green color option as well. It will have the alert slider and power button on the right side, while the volume buttons will be on the left.
The phone’s triple-camera setup is said to feature a 50MP Sony IMX890 sensor, a 48MP ultra-wide lens, and a 32MP telephoto sensor. For selfies, there will be a 32MP front camera inside the hole-punch cutout.
One of the leaked design renders revealed that the phone will have a hole-punch cutout in the upper left corner for the front-facing camera. The device will sport a 6.7-inch curved AMOLED display with QHD+ resolution and 120Hz refresh rate support. OnePlus has already confirmed that its upcoming flagship will feature the new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 SoC. come with 16GB of RAM in select regions and offer up to 256GB of internal storage.
It will also pack a 5000mAh battery and support 100W fast charging. The device will run Android 13-based OxygenOS 13 out of the box. The exact release date is expected to be announced very soon. We will share more details when they become available.
